Man charged after bomb found on the back seat of a car in Kingsley

A man has been charged with making a bomb after police found explosives on the back seat of his car - during an incident that created traffic chaos in the northern suburbs.

The 25-year-old's BMW was stopped at a booze bus on Hepburn Avenue in Kingsley at around 2.30pm on Friday afternoon for a routine drug and alcohol test.

Witnesses on the scene claimed the BMW driver had tried to make a U-turn getaway from the booze bus and crashed.

Police confirmed on Saturday two men in the car were detained and the area was cordoned off for two hours after bomb squad officers were called to the scene and took away the device for forensic testing.

The 25-year-old Woodvale man has been charged with making or possessing explosives under suspicious circumstances.

He was due to appear at Perth Magistrates Court on Saturday morning.
